About

The Richard Hart Bursary supports Global Majority students from the Bristol region undertaking selected postgraduate research and professional programmes at UWE Bristol. The bursary aims to widen participation in higher education by providing financial assistance to eligible students.

Description

The Richard Hart Bursary was established in memory of Richard Hart, a Jamaican political activist, lawyer, historian and honorary graduate of UWE Bristol. It is available to Home (UK) students from the Bristol area who identify as Global Majority and are studying selected Master's, PhD or Professional Doctorate programmes.

Recipients are expected to complete a short project related to widening participation in higher education and may be invited to support future students through mentoring or teaching.

Benefits

£2,000 for one academic year.

Eligibility

  • Must be classed as a Home (UK) student.
  • Must identify as Global Majority.
  • Must be from the Bristol region.

Must be enrolled on one of the eligible programmes:

  • MSc Health Psychology
  • MSc Business and Organisational Psychology
  • MSc Sport and Exercise Psychology
  • MA Counselling and Psychotherapy
  • MSc Psychology (Conversion)
  • Doctor of Counselling Psychology
  • Doctor of Health Psychology
  • PhD.
